nginx怎么设置二级域名
Nginx如何设置二级域名 🌐🔧
在网站搭建和运维过程中,合理设置二级域名是提高网站结构清晰度和用户体验的重要步骤,Nginx作为一款高性能的Web服务器,支持多域名解析,下面我将详细讲解如何在Nginx中设置二级域名。👇
准备工作
在开始设置之前,我们需要确保以下几点:
- 域名解析:在域名服务商处将二级域名的DNS解析到你的服务器IP地址。
- 域名绑定:在服务器上配置相应的域名解析,确保可以解析到正确的IP地址。
- Nginx安装:确保Nginx已经安装在你的服务器上。
设置步骤
编辑Nginx配置文件
我们需要编辑Nginx的配置文件,通常情况下,Nginx的配置文件位于
/etc/nginx/nginx.conf或者
/etc/nginx/sites-available/目录下。
目录下。
sudo nano /etc/nginx/sites-available/your_second_domain.conf
添加二级域名配置
在配置文件中,添加以下内容,其中
your_second_domain.com替换为你的二级域名:
替换为你的二级域名:
server { listen 80; server_name your_second_domain.com; root /var/www/your_second_domain; index index.html index.htm index.php; location / { try_files $uri $uri/ /index.php?$query_string; } # 如果需要配置SSL,请取消下面两行的注释 # listen 443 ssl; # ssl_certificate /etc/ssl/certs/your_second_domain.com.crt; # ssl_certificate_key /etc/ssl/private/your_second_domain.com.key;}创建符号链接
为了使Nginx能够识别新的配置文件,我们需要创建一个符号链接到
/etc/nginx/sites-enabled/目录:
目录:
sudo ln -s /etc/nginx/sites-available/your_second_domain.conf /etc/nginx/sites-enabled/
重启Nginx服务
重启Nginx服务以应用新的配置:
sudo systemctl restart nginx
验证配置
在浏览器中输入你的二级域名,如果一切设置正确,你应该能够看到网站内容。🎉
注意事项
- 确保服务器上的文件路径与配置文件中的路径一致。
- 如果你的网站使用了SSL证书,请确保正确配置SSL相关参数。
- 在修改Nginx配置文件后,务必重启Nginx服务。
通过以上步骤,你就可以在Nginx中成功设置二级域名了,希望这篇文章能帮助你解决问题,祝你网站运营顺利!🚀🌟
The End
发布于:2025-10-11,除非注明,否则均为原创文章,转载请注明出处。